It’s all about location, location, location at family-run Landsker Camping, a spacious family-friendly site at Canaston Bridge in Pembrokeshire. As well as a spectacular setting in roughly 10 acres of young woodland, you have the added bonus of being 10 minutes’ drive from big attractions like Picton Castle Gardens, Wild Lakes Wales and Folly Farm Adventure Park and Zoo. With views over peaceful countryside, the generously sized, flat grass pitches are sheltered by trees and spaced out for extra privacy (they’re also dotted by wild flowers in spring). You’re welcome to explore the woods, and let the kids splash around in the stream. For family adventures or exercise with any doggy chums, a footpath from the site leads directly to the 60-mile, looped Landsker Borderlands Trail, and 10 minutes’ drive has you on the trails through Canaston Woods. Facilities on site include a toilet block, showers and a washnig-up area. There’s a firepit on every pitch, so pick up barbecue essentials in the market town of Narberth (10 minutes’ drive – there are lots of restaurants and pubs there too). This area is known for its fabulously dark skies (and associated excellent stargazing) – that means torches are advisable for after-dark manoeuvres.

Local attractions

So will it be the lions, tigers and zebras at Manor Wildlife Park, or the vintage fairground and animal barn at Folly Farm Adventure Park and Zoo (both 10 minutes’ drive) first? And don’t worry, there’s plenty more to do locally. Perhaps you can lose the kids (and find them again, of course) in Picton Castle Escape Rooms (10 minutes) – and don’t forget the photogenic remains of 12th-century Llawhaden Castle (five minutes) make a lovely spot for a picnic. For family rambles in the Pembrokeshire Coast National Park, head for the tree-lined paths of Minwear Wood, or follow the Cleddau Trail (both five minutes) along the course of the river. And for action-filled days out, the floating inflatable climbing course, wakeboarding sessions and climbing wall at Wild Lakes Wales (10 minutes) or the mountain-biking tracks at Llys y Frân Country Park and Reservoir (20 minutes) should fit the bill nicely. There’s more family fun to be had on the Pembrokeshire coastline too, with sandy beaches at Tenby (25 minutes), Saundersfoot and Amroth (both 20 minutes) for rockpooling and sandcastle building.
